Oversee the development, strategy, and execution of specialized lighting products tailored for fire and EMS emergency vehicle markets, ensuring the solutions meet the needs of first responders in critical situations.
This position requires a deep understanding of how fire apparatus is manufactured, ensuring seamless integration of lighting solutions with fire trucks and emergency vehicles.
